Deck Waterproofing in Seattle, WA
Deck waterproofing services involve applying protective coatings or membranes to outdoor decks to prevent water infiltration and damage. This service is suitable for a variety of projects, including wood, composite, or concrete decks, especially those exposed to frequent moisture or seasonal weather changes. Property owners often seek waterproofing to extend the lifespan of their decks, prevent wood rot, and maintain a safe, slip-resistant surface. Before requesting waterproofing, it’s helpful to understand the current condition of the deck, the type of material, and any existing issues such as cracks or deterioration that may need to be addressed.
Homeowners typically want to know what waterproofing options are available, how the process will impact their outdoor space, and the expected durability of the applied coatings. It’s also important to consider the preparation required, such as cleaning or repairing the surface, to ensure proper adhesion and effectiveness. Proper waterproofing can help protect the underlying structure from water damage, reduce maintenance needs, and preserve the aesthetic appeal of outdoor living areas.

Deck Waterproofing Questions
What is deck waterproofing? Deck waterproofing involves applying protective materials to prevent water from penetrating the surface, helping to extend the life of the deck.
Why is waterproofing important for decks? Waterproofing helps prevent water damage, wood rot, and mold growth, maintaining the deck's safety and appearance over time.
What types of decks benefit from waterproofing? Both wooden and composite decks, especially those exposed to frequent rain or moisture, can benefit from waterproofing treatments.
When should a deck be waterproofed? Waterproofing is recommended during initial installation or when signs of water damage, such as warping or staining, begin to appear.
